Xử Lý Lỗi Elementor Query ID: Nguyên Nhân Và Cách Khắc Phục Chi Tiết Khi sử dụng Elementor Pro để xây dựng website WordPress, một trong những tính năng mạnh mẽ nhất là khả năng truy vấn dữ liệu động thông qua Query ID. Tuy nhiên, không ít người dùng gặp phải lỗi liên quan đến elementor query id lỗi trong quá trình thiết lập hiển thị bài viết, custom post type hoặc các nguồn dữ liệu khác. Hiểu được bản chất của lỗi này và cách xử lý triệt để sẽ giúp bạn tiết kiệm hàng giờ debug và tránh những rắc rối không đáng có.
Bản Chất Của Query ID Trong Elementor

Query ID trong Elementor là một tham số nhận dạng dùng để xác định một truy vấn dữ liệu cụ thể khi sử dụng các widget như Posts, Portfolio, Archive, hoặc khi tạo các mẫu động (dynamic templates). Mỗi Query ID hoạt động như một định danh duy nhất cho phép Elementor biết chính xác nguồn dữ liệu nào cần lấy và hiển thị. Khi một elementor query id lỗi xảy ra, điều đó có nghĩa là hệ thống không thể nhận diện hoặc xử lý đúng tham số ID mà
Hoàn toàn có thể, nhưng mỗi query ID phải có tên duy nhất. Nếu bạn vô tình đặt trùng tên cho hai widget khác nhau, lỗi xung đột sẽ xảy ra. Hãy đặt tên có hậu tố như “sanpham-hot”, “sanpham-moi” để phân biệt.
Sau khi cập nhật Elementor, query ID cũ bị lỗi, phải làm sao?
Trước tiên, hãy regenerate CSS từ Elementor > Tools. Nếu lỗi vẫn còn, vào widget đó và click “Edit Query” rồi save lại mà không thay đổi gì. Điều này sẽ cập nhật cấu hình query theo phiên bản mới.
Lỗi query ID có ảnh hưởng đến tốc độ trang không?
Có thể. Một query ID được thiết lập không tối ưu (ví dụ truy vấn quá nhiều bài viết mà không có giới hạn) có thể làm chậm trang. Khi gặp lỗi, hệ thống có thể thực hiện các query fallback không hiệu quả, ảnh hưởng đến thời gian tải.
Lưu Ý Quan Trọng Khi Làm Việc Với Query ID Trong Elementor

Luôn ghi chú lại tất cả query ID bạn đã tạo và vị trí sử dụng. Khi có thay đổi về cấu trúc dữ liệu (xóa category, thay đổi custom post type), hãy kiểm tra và cập nhật query ID tương ứng. Không nên sử dụng query ID cho các query quá phức tạp với nhiều điều kiện lồng nhau. Nếu cần logic phức tạp, hãy dùng custom PHP hoặc các plugin chuyên dụng như JetSmartFilters, FacetWP. Luôn cập nhật Elementor lên bản mới nhất và theo dõi changelog để biết các thay đổi về API query. Cộng đồng Elementor trên Facebook và diễn đàn WordPress.org là nguồn tham khảo hữu ích khi gặp lỗi.
Kết Luận

Elementor query ID lỗi là một vấn đề phổ biến nhưng hoàn toàn có thể xử lý được nếu bạn hiểu rõ nguyên nhân và áp dụng quy trình debug có hệ thống. Từ việc kiểm tra cú pháp, xác minh nguồn dữ liệu, xung đột plugin cho đến các bước nâng cao như debug log hay tăng memory limit, tất cả đều nằm trong tầm tay của bạn. Nếu sau khi thử tất cả các bước mà lỗi vẫn còn, hãy cân nhắc sử dụng giải pháp thay thế như custom query PHP hoặc các plugin chuyên sâu. Quan trọng nhất, luôn sao lưu dữ liệu và thử nghiệm trên môi trường staging trước khi áp dụng thay đổi lên trang chính. Với cách tiếp cận bài bản, bạn sẽ không còn lo sợ mỗi khi gặp lỗi liên quan đến query ID nữa.

- Cách sửa lỗi “theme wordpress undefined function” triệt để và chi tiết nhất
- Khắc Phục WordPress Container Restart Loop: Nguyên Nhân Và Cách Xử Lý Triệt Để
- Hướng dẫn chi tiết cách xóa user WordPress an toàn và triệt để
- Plugin LMS Lỗi Giảng Viên: Nguyên Nhân, Cách Khắc Phục và Giải Pháp Toàn Diện
- Hướng dẫn chi tiết cách khắc phục Elementor xung đột ACF hiệu quả 2024














